PKL 12: Telugu Titans' full schedule & squad for Pro Kabaddi 2025

Telugu Titans will start their campaign against Tamil Thalaivas in PKL 12.
Telugu Titans showcased one of the best performances in their Pro Kabaddi League history in the previous season. Although they missed the playoff spot by a thin margin, the fierce competition they provided throughout the season was commendable.
It was the first time after season 4 that they reached so close to qualification. However, stepping into the next season, the fans and team management would be hoping for an even better result. Krishan Kumar Hooda has been given the duty of guiding the Titans once again as the head coach.
Hooda has begun his duties for PKL 12 and has put together a squad to lift their first PKL trophy. After retaining Pawan Sehrawat for two consecutive years, the Titans let go of their former captain ahead of PKL 12 and will be moving forward with a new captain and a new set of raiders.

Telugu Titans’ full squad:
The Telugu Titans will be eyeing playoffs berth in PKL 12. They have strengthened their squad for the upcoming season. With Bharat Hooda’s all-round capabilities and Shubham Shinde’s defensive prowess, combined with their retained core, they’re ready to challenge the established order and make their presence felt.
Raiders: Chetan Sahu, Nitin, Rohit, Praful Sudam Zaware (left raider), Jai Bhagwan, Manjeet, Ashish Narwal.
Defenders: Ajit Pandurang Pawar (left cover), Sagar (right cover), Ankit (left corner), Avi Duhan (right cover), Bantu (left corner), Rahul Dagar (left corner), Aman (left corner), AmirHossein Ejlali (F) (right corner), Shubham Shinde (right corner).
All-rounders: Shankar Bhimraj Gadai, Ganesh Parki (F), Vijay Malik, Bharat.
Head Coach: Krishan Kumar Hooda.
Telugu Titans’ full schedule-
Vizag (Rajiv Gandhi Indoor Stadium)-
- Aug 29 (Friday)– Telugu Titans vs Tamil Thalaivas
- Aug 30 (Saturday)– Telugu Titans vs UP Yoddhas
- Sep 4 (Thursday)– Jaipur Pink Panthers vs Telugu Titans
- Sep 7 (Sunday)– Bengal Warriorz vs Telugu Titans
- Sep 10 (Wednesday)– U Mumba vs Telugu Titans
Jaipur (Sawai Mansingh Indoor Stadium)-
- Sep 13 (Saturday)– Puneri Paltan vs Telugu Titans
- Sep 15 (Monday)– Bengaluru Bulls vs Telugu Titans
- Sep 17 (Wednesday)– Telugu Titans vs Dabang Delhi K.C.
- Sep 19 (Friday)– Tamil Thalaivas vs Telugu Titans
- Sep 23 (Tuesday)– Gujarat Giants vs Telugu Titans
Chennai (SDAT Multipurpose Indoor Stadium)-
- Sep 30 (Tuesday)– Telugu Titans vs Patna Pirates
- Oct 5 (Sunday)– UP Yoddhas vs Telugu Titans
- Oct 8 (Wednesday)– Telugu Titans vs Haryana Steelers
Delhi (Thyagaraj Sports Complex)-
- Oct 15 (Wednesday)– Telugu Titans vs Bengal Warriorz
- Oct 16 (Thursday)– Telugu Titans vs U Mumba
- Oct 18 (Saturday)– Telugu Titans vs Puneri Paltan
- Oct 19 (Sunday)– Telugu Titans vs Gujarat Giants
- Oct 22 (Wednesday)– Haryana Steelers vs Telugu Titans
When will PKL 12 start?
PKL 12 is set to begin on Friday, August 29.
Which cities will host PKL 12?
Vizag, Jaipur, Chennai, and Delhi are set to host PKL 12.
Who are the defending champions of PKL?
Haryana Steelers are the defending champions of PKL. They defeated the Patna Pirates to lift their maiden title in Season 11.
